LOGLINE
Controversial painter Joe Coleman, known for his intricate portraits of serial killers and outlaws, undertakes his most challenging subject yet — a seven foot portrait of his wife, Whitney.

SYNOPSIS
Joe Coleman is an artist who plumbs the darkest reaches of the human psyche. Painter, performer and collector of oddities, he lives and creates in the liminal realm between light and shadow, guided by his relentless search for ‘soul’. Death, murder and violence are common themes woven throughout his work, with subjects running the gamut from outlaws and serial killers to friends and family. Both lauded and vilified, Joe’s artwork rarely produces passive responses from the audience. His paintings have been exhibited in museums around the world and hang in the collections of Iggy Pop, Jim Jarmusch, Leonardo Di Caprio, Johnny Depp and late, legendary artist H.R. Giger.

Currently in production, HOW DARK MY LOVE is a new kind of non-fiction feature, unbound by established rules of the genre. Using a cinéma vérité approach combined with a dramatic narrative aesthetic creates a film that does not look or feel like a documentary. Real. Visceral. Dangerous. HOW DARK MY LOVE explores the life and vision of this unique artist and reveals how sometimes the brightest of truths can lie in the darkest of shadows.
